"A recipe that lets the peaches shine. To prevent soggy double crust pies, be sure to make slits in the top crust so the steam can escape as the pie is baking. Also, bake double crust pies in bottom third of the oven so the bottom crust cooks enough to prevent sogginess and so that the top crust does not brown too quickly. To prevent a mess in the oven,..."

"This is a wonderful pie recipe to use up all of those yummy and sweet summer peaches. To make peeling easier dip peaches in boiling water for 30 seconds then plunge into sink or bowl of ice water. Once cool, you will be able to just rub the skin off (this will only work on ripe peaches). If you top this with a big scoop of vanilla ice cream it will..."
